Understanding Steel Panel Dent Repair Process
Understanding Steel Panel Dent Repair Process
Steel panel dent repair is a meticulous process designed to restore damaged vehicle bodies to their original condition. It begins with an assessment by professionals who inspect the dented area, determining the extent of the damage. Using specialized tools and techniques, they carefully remove the dented panel from the vehicle. This step requires precision to avoid further damaging surrounding panels or structural components. Once removed, the panel is taken to a controlled environment where it undergoes frame straightening if necessary, ensuring alignment with the rest of the car’s body.
After frame straightening, skilled technicians employ various methods, including manual and automated processes, to gently press the dented area back into place. This process effectively reduces the size of the dent, making it nearly invisible. Subsequent steps involve cleaning and priming the panel to prepare it for painting. The application of car paint services is then undertaken with meticulous care, matching the original color precisely. This attention to detail ensures that the repaired area seamlessly blends in with the rest of the vehicle body, maintaining its aesthetic appeal and structural integrity within the vehicle body shop.
Preparing for the Service and What to Expect
Before your steel panel dent repair service, it’s important to prepare by gathering all necessary information about the damage. Take photos from various angles to document the extent of the dent and any surrounding issues, like rust or paint chips. Prepare your vehicle by cleaning it thoroughly, as this will make the repair process easier and ensure better adhesion of new panels.
During the repair process, you can expect a meticulous approach from professionals skilled in steel panel dent repair. They’ll assess the damage, create a custom repair plan, and use specialized tools to remove the dent without damaging the surrounding metal. While they work, you might notice some noise from machinery and the movement of panels, but rest assured that experienced technicians prioritize precision and quality. Post-Repair Care and Maintenance Tips
After a successful steel panel dent repair, proper care and maintenance are essential to ensure the longevity of the repair work. It’s crucial to keep the repaired area clean by regularly washing your vehicle using mild detergents and soft cloths. Avoid using abrasive materials or hard brushes that can scratch the surface. Additionally, applying a protective coating or wax can enhance the finish and shield against future dents, though this is not always necessary.
For optimal post-repair care, regular inspections are recommended. Keep an eye out for any signs of damage, such as rust spots or paint peeling, which could indicate underlying issues. In case of severe weather conditions, like frequent storms or heavy snowfall, consider taking extra precautions to protect your vehicle. This may include using a car cover to safeguard against tree sap, bird droppings, and other environmental contaminants that can affect both the repaired and unrepaired areas of your car body, including those requiring auto glass replacement.
